vai aí um segredinho... mas não conta pra ninguém, viu! procedure TForm1.SalvarHTML (WB:TWebBrowser; const FileName : string); var PersistStream: IPersistStreamInit; Stream: IStream; FileStream: TFileStream; begin if not Assigned(WB.Document) then begin ShowMessage('O documento está sendo carregado! Aguarde...'); Exit; end;
PersistStream := WB.Document as IPersistStreamInit; FileStream := TFileStream.Create(FileName, fmCreate); try Stream := TStreamAdapter.Create(FileStream, soReference) as IStream; if Failed(PersistStream.Save(Stream, True)) then ShowMessage('SaveAs HTML fail!'); finally FileStream.Free; end; end; daí, vc chama num evento qq: SalvarHTML(WebBrowser1,'c:\DOC.html'); e vai no c:\ pra vc ver... ----- Original Message ----- From: Fernando - Hotforms To: delphi-br@yahoogrupos.com.br Sent: Saturday, July 08, 2006 11:06 AM Subject: [delphi-br] Manipular TWebBrowser Alguém por acaso sabe como posso manipular o TWebBrowser, preciso fazer com que ele clique em um determinado link, mas para isso precisava saber o conteúdo do mesmo. Sei que é possível, só não sei como! Se alguém tiver uma dica ai, ficarei grato! Abraços, *Fernando dos Santos Sousa* -- __________ Informação do NOD32 IMON 1.1651 (20060708) __________ Esta mensagem foi verificada pelo NOD32 sistema antivírus http://www.eset.com.br [As partes desta mensagem que não continham texto foram removidas] -- <<<<< F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M >>>>> <*> Para ver as mensagens antigas, acesse: http://br.groups.yahoo.com/group/delphi-br/messages <*> Para falar com o moderador, envie um e-mail para: [EMAIL PROTECTED] Links do Yahoo! Grupos <*> Para visitar o site do seu grupo na web, acesse: http://br.groups.yahoo.com/group/delphi-br/ <*> Para sair deste grupo, envie um e-mail para: [EMAIL PROTECTED] <*> O uso que você faz do Yahoo! Grupos está sujeito aos: http://br.yahoo.com/info/utos.html